Mobile Electricity 4/14 --> Ultra Fast Charger Model Battery Weight Vehicle Weight Batt/Veh. Rate Battery Cap. imiev 150 kg 1090 kg 13.8 % 16 kwh i3 204 kg 1300 kg 15.7 % 33 kwh Leaf 300 kg 1490 kg 20.1 % 40 kwh ZOE 305 kg 1480 kg 20.6 % 41 kwh Bolt 435 kg 1624 kg 26.8 % 60 kwh ModelS 600 kg 2108 kg 28.5 % 85 kwh

Conclusion 14/14 Vehicle-grid integration projects are standing up in worldwide. V2G system is ready, regulation is under construction, in Japan. Electric Vehicle Charge-and-Share Campus Demonstration --> Live drive condition, car-sharing among students --> Building and household energy management (local control) --> Ancillary services emulation (global control) Combination, Portfolio stratagy is important Yutaka Ota yota@tcu.ac.jp http://www.psl.ee.tcu.ac.jp
